On July 5th, the Standing Committee of the Provincial Party Committee organized a conference to ask for the opinions from the former provincial leaders to contribute to the 1/10,000 scale urban master planning project of Hoa Binh City by 2045. Mr. Nguyen Phi Long, the alternate member of the Party Central Committee, and the Secretary of the Provincial Party Committee chaired the conference.

The general urban planning project of Hoa Binh City by 2045 takes the axis of Da River as the central axis of the development; At the same time, it is necessary to develop along both sides of Hoa Lac - Hoa Binh city route. 

At the conference, the former provincial leaders have highly agreed on the urban master planning project of Hoa Binh City and they have given the additional and complete comments to ensure the feasibility and compatibility with other plans. 

The conference has also contributed the opinions on the Martyrs' Temple project in Hoa Binh province. 

Making the conclusion speech, the Secretary of the Provincial Party Committee emphasizes that the preparation of Hoa Binh City's general urban planning will contribute to realizing the goal of building Hoa Binh City into a civilized, modern, harmonious, and sustainable urban area with the green and advanced architecture, and typical culture of Hoa Binh; Meeting the requirements of management and development of economy, culture, urban space, and landscape architecture. He also acknowledges the comments of the delegates at the conference and requests that Hoa Binh City should absorb and complete the Project according to the regulations.
